About This Property
Luxurious living in Uptown Park. All utilities covered, including electrical, gas, water and basic cable tv) for one bed/one bath beautiful condo apt. with ceiling fan. Completely updated with engineered hardwood floors.. All recent stainless steel appliances in kitchen with pantry and skylight. Spa like bathroom w/skylight and walk-in glass shower. Convenient gated, covered assigned parking. No dogs, please. Plenty of storage space.

Uptown Houston comprises the area east of Interstate 610 between I-10 and I-69, a large swath of the city that blends the relaxed pace of the suburbs with urban glitz and energy. One of the area’s most famous attractions is the stunning Galleria, the largest shopping mall in Texas, which employs thousands in its high-end boutiques. Nearby, a thriving dining and entertainment district supplies the neighborhood with an eclectic variety of off-hours attractions. The sprawling Memorial Park sits right across the highway, and locals love to stroll through the Houston Arboretum and hit the links of the Memorial Park Golf Course.
The local housing market ranges from single-family homes to high-rise condominiums, with many surprisingly affordable apartments in the mix as well; while the section closest to Interstate 610 and the Galleria tends to be more urbanized, most of the neighborhood is suburban in nature.
